Location and Accessibility

Nestled conveniently between Sheikh Zayed Road and the Dubai World Trade Centre, Zabeel Park is centrally located, serving as a connective tissue for various neighborhoods. Its accessibility is one of its strongest suits. Visitors can easily reach it via several modes of public transport, including the Dubai Metro, with the nearest station being Al Jafiliya. The park features ample parking space, ensuring even those driving in from other parts of the city find it easy to visit.

For those preferring a more leisurely approach, several bus routes stop nearby. Once you get here, it’s hard to miss the main entrances, framed by striking sculptures that hint at the diverse experiences within.

History and Development

Zabeel Park was inaugurated in 2005, marking a significant milestone in Dubai’s urban landscape transformation. Originally barren land, it has now evolved into a lush expanse over 47 hectares, combining aesthetics with utility. The vision behind its development was to create a space not only for leisure but also for community events and cultural activities.

Local authorities aimed to promote not just the beauty of nature but also create a platform for education about ecological issues. Several areas in the park are dedicated to native plants and trees, illustrating biodiversity and the importance of conservation. The park’s ongoing enhancements over the years have made it a versatile locale for sports, social gatherings, and family outings, effectively marrying recreation with environmental consciousness.

Operating Hours and Entrance Fees

Zabeel Park is open all week, accommodating visitors with varying schedules. Typically, the park welcomes guests from 8 AM to 10 PM. These operating hours allow families, tourists, and joggers to fit the park into their daily plans, whether they prefer enjoying the park at sunrise or during a cool evening stroll.

Entrance to the park is generally free, making it an accessible destination for all. However, certain events and designated areas might have a fee. For example, if you want to access specialized attractions or participate in events, a small nominal fee might apply. Always check ahead if you're planning a visit around specific events, as prices and timings occasionally vary.

Sustainability Initiatives

Zabeel Park’s commitment to sustainability is reflected through several initiatives that aim to minimize its ecological footprint. For example, the use of solar-powered lighting helps in reducing energy consumption while providing safety and ambiance. These solar panels are strategically placed throughout the park, showcasing a conscious effort to harness renewable energy.

Additionally, the park implements an efficient irrigation system that uses recycled water. This not only conserves precious resources but also supports the maintenance of lush greenery that attracts visitors year-round. It's worth noting how these initiatives resonate beyond the park itself, as they serve as a model for similar developments in the area.
